Package jp.vmi.selenium.selenese.utils
Class LangUtils
- java.lang.Object
-
- jp.vmi.selenium.selenese.utils.LangUtils
-
public class LangUtils extends Object
Language utilities.
-
-
Field Summary
Fields Modifier and Type Field Description static String[]EMPTY_STRING_ARRAYEmpty String array.
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static Stringcapitalize(String s)Capitalize string.static booleancontainsIgnoreCase(String s, String ss)Checks if s contains ss without case sensitivity.static booleanisBlank(String s)Checks if s is null, empty or whitespace only.static Stringjoin(CharSequence delimiter, Iterable<?> iterable)Join iterable to string.static Stringjoin(CharSequence delimiter, Iterator<?> iterator)Join iterator to string.static Stringjoin(CharSequence delimiter, Stream<?> stream)Join stream to string.static Stringuncapitalize(String s)Uncapitalize string.
-
-
-
Field Detail
-
EMPTY_STRING_ARRAY
public static final String[] EMPTY_STRING_ARRAY
Empty String array.
-
-
Method Detail
-
isBlank
public static boolean isBlank(String s)
Checks if s is null, empty or whitespace only.- Parameters:
s- a string or null.- Returns:
- true if s is null, empty string, or whitespace only.
-
containsIgnoreCase
public static boolean containsIgnoreCase(String s, String ss)
Checks if s contains ss without case sensitivity.- Parameters:
s- a string.ss- a substring.- Returns:
- true if s contains ss without case sensitivity.
-
capitalize
public static String capitalize(String s)
Capitalize string.- Parameters:
s- a string.- Returns:
- capitalized string.
-
uncapitalize
public static String uncapitalize(String s)
Uncapitalize string.- Parameters:
s- a string.- Returns:
- uncapitalized string.
-
join
public static String join(CharSequence delimiter, Stream<?> stream)
Join stream to string.- Parameters:
delimiter- delimiterstream- stream- Returns:
- joined string
-
join
public static String join(CharSequence delimiter, Iterator<?> iterator)
Join iterator to string.- Parameters:
delimiter- delimiteriterator- iterator- Returns:
- joined string
-
join
public static String join(CharSequence delimiter, Iterable<?> iterable)
Join iterable to string.- Parameters:
delimiter- delimiteriterable- iterable- Returns:
- joined string
-
-